Dy7(PtTe)2 crystallizes in the orthorhombic Imm2 space group. The structure is three-dimensional. there are four inequivalent Dy sites. In the first Dy site, Dy is bonded in a 5-coordinate geometry to two equivalent Pt and three Te atoms. Both Dy–Pt bond lengths are 2.88 Å. There are one shorter (3.13 Å) and two longer (3.21 Å) Dy–Te bond lengths. In the second Dy site, Dy is bonded in a 4-coordinate geometry to three equivalent Pt and one Te atom. There are two shorter (2.87 Å) and one longer (3.18 Å) Dy–Pt bond lengths. The Dy–Te bond length is 3.19 Å. In the third Dy site, Dy is bonded in a 4-coordinate geometry to two equivalent Pt and two equivalent Te atoms. Both Dy–Pt bond lengths are 2.91 Å. Both Dy–Te bond lengths are 3.17 Å. In the fourth Dy site, Dy is bonded in a 3-coordinate geometry to three Te atoms. There are two shorter (3.21 Å) and one longer (3.26 Å) Dy–Te bond lengths. Pt is bonded in a 7-coordinate geometry to seven Dy atoms. There are two inequivalent Te sites. In the first Te site, Te is bonded in a 8-coordinate geometry to eight Dy atoms. In the second Te site, Te is bonded in a 7-coordinate geometry to seven Dy atoms.
